How to get from Awoshie Amangoase to North Kaneshie by bus?

From Awoshie Amangoase to North Kaneshie by bus

To get from Awoshie Amangoase to North Kaneshie in Accra, take the 378 bus from Awoshie station to Kwashieman station. Next, take the 328 bus from Kwashieman Junction station to Meridian Chemist station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 40 min. Alternative route from Awoshie Amangoase to North Kaneshie by bus via 223 and 284

To get from Awoshie Amangoase to North Kaneshie in Accra, take the 223 bus from Mallam station to Kaneshie Foot Bridge station. Next, take the 284 bus from Kaneshie Market Station station to Meridian Chemist station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 51 min.
